Chocolate-Covered Yogurt Coconut Strawberries

These healthy strawberry bites are stuffed with a creamy coconut-yogurt filling, dipped in dark chocolate, and chilled into the perfect sweet snack.
Ingredients
- 120 g Greek yogurt
- 100 g unsweetened shredded coconut
- 2 tsp honey
- 10-12 large fresh strawberries
- 130 g dark chocolate, chopped
- 1 tsp coconut oil
- 2 tbsp chopped nuts, for topping (optional)
Instructions
- Wash and thoroughly dry the strawberries, then remove the tops if desired and hollow the centers slightly to make room for the filling.
- In a bowl, mix the Greek yogurt, shredded coconut, and honey until thick and well combined.
- Fill or coat the strawberries with the yogurt-coconut mixture, shaping it neatly around each strawberry. Place them on a lined tray and refrigerate for 20-30 minutes, until firm.
- Add the dark chocolate and coconut oil to a heatproof bowl and melt gently in the microwave in short bursts or over a double boiler, stirring until smooth.
- Dip each chilled strawberry into the melted chocolate, letting the excess drip off, then place back on the lined tray.
- Sprinkle with chopped nuts if using, then refrigerate again for 15-20 minutes, or until the chocolate is fully set.
- Serve chilled for a refreshing, chocolatey snack.
Tip: Make sure the strawberries are completely dry before coating, or the filling and chocolate won’t stick properly.
